- The distance between Pocatello, Idaho, Usa and Deir-Alla, Jordan is approximately 11,055 km or 6,870 mi.
- To reach Pocatello, Idaho in this distance one would set out from Deir-Alla bearing 337°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Pocatello, Idaho bearing 206.9° or SSW .
- Pocatello, Idaho has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Deir-Alla has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
- Pocatello, Idaho is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Deir-Alla is in or near the subtropical thorn woodland bi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 15.6 °C (28.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.5 °C (17.1°F) more in Pocatello, Idaho.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 28.4 mm (1.1 in) more which is equivalent to 28.4 l/m² (0.7 US gal/ft²) or 284,000 l/ha (30,361 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.7° lower in Pocatello, Idaho than in Deir-Alla.
